So if you ever want to know how to take out a range here is what you need to do.

1. Shut off the power at the panel.
2. Make sure you have shut the power off at the panel.
3. Ask several times "Are you sure you shut the power off at the panel?"
4.Find the wiring.



5. Get a voltage meter and set to correct current.


5. Make sure you know the difference between
AC and DC
.....no not the band...
I mean Direct Current and Alternating Current
 Batteries are DC while the electricity in your home is AC.
7. Once you have the voltage meter set to the correct current check the wiring by putting the probe on the exposed wires.
If the voltage meter doesn't move that means there is no power.


8. Then you are safe to clip the wires.
